SRS DTC Troubleshooting: 44-1x

DTC 44-1x ("x" can be 0 thru 9 or A thru F):

No Signal From the Right Side Impact Sensor (first) (4-door)

Special Tools Required

- SRS Inflator Simulator 07SAZ-TB4011A
- SRS Simulator Lead L 070AZ-SNAA300

NOTE:

- Before doing this troubleshooting procedure, find out if the vehicle was in a collision. If so, verify that all the required components were replaced with new components, of the correct part number, and that they were properly installed Service and Repair.
- Before doing this troubleshooting procedure, review SRS Precautions and Procedures Service and Repair, General Troubleshooting Information Reading and Clearing Diagnostic Trouble Codes, and Battery Terminal Disconnection and Reconnection Procedures.

1. Clear the DTCs with the HDS.

2. Turn the ignition switch to ON (II), then wait for 10 seconds.

3. Check for DTCs with the HDS.

Is DTC 44-1x indicated?

YES -

Go to step 4.

NO -

Intermittent failure, the system is OK at this time. Go to Troubleshooting Intermittent Failures. If another DTC is indicated, troubleshoot the DTC.

4. Turn the ignition switch to LOCK (0).

5. Disconnect the negative cable from the battery, then wait at least 3 minutes.

6. Check for these connector connections and harness.

- SRS unit connector B (39P) and the SRS unit.
- SRS floor wire harness 2P connector and the right side impact sensor (first) Side Impact Sensor (First) Replacement (4-Door).

Are the connections and harness OK?

YES -

Go to step 7.

NO -

Repair the poor connector connections or replace the harness, then clear the DTC, and retest.

- If poor connector connections are repaired, and DTC 44-1x is still present, go to step 7.
- If the harness is replaced, and DTC 44-1x is still present, replace the SRS unit Service and Repair.

7. Disconnect SRS unit connector B (39P) from the SRS unit.

8. Disconnect the SRS floor wire harness 2P connector from the right side impact sensor (first) Side Impact Sensor (First) Replacement (4-Door).

9. Measure the resistance between SRS unit connector B (39P) terminals No. 38 and No. 39. There should be an open circuit or at least 1 MOhms.





Is the resistance as specified?

YES -

Go to step 10.

NO -

Short to another wire in the SRS floor wire harness; replace the SRS floor wire harness, then clear the DTC.

10. Measure the resistance between body ground and SRS unit connector B (39P) terminals No. 38 and No. 39 individually. There should be an open circuit or at least 1 MOhms.





Is the resistance as specified?

YES -

Go to step 11.

NO -

Short to ground in the SRS floor wire harness; replace the SRS floor wire harness, then clear the DTC.

11. Reconnect the negative cable to the battery.

12. Turn the ignition switch to ON (II).

13. Measure the voltage between body ground and SRS unit connector B (39P) terminals No. 38 and No. 39 individually. There should be less than 0.2 V.





Is the voltage as specified?

YES -

Go to step 14.

NO -

Short to power in the SRS floor wire harness; replace the SRS floor wire harness, then clear the DTC.

14. Turn the ignition switch to LOCK (0).

15. Connect the black terminal (A) of SRS simulator lead L to the SRS inflator simulator (jumper connector), then connect SRS simulator lead L to the SRS floor wire harness 2P connector (B).






16. Measure the resistance between SRS unit connector B (39P) terminals No. 38 and No. 39. There should be less than 1.0 Ohms.





Is the resistance as specified?

YES -

Faulty right side impact sensor (first) or SRS unit; replace the right side impact sensor (first) Side Impact Sensor (First) Replacement (4-Door), then clear the DTC, and retest. If the DTC is still present, replace the SRS unit Service and Repair.

NO -

Open in the SRS floor wire harness; replace the SRS floor wire harness, then clear the DTC.
